Good news is that many of the Relics and artwork were rescued, including the sacred Crown of Thorns among other things. All moved to an undisclosed location for safe keeping. They saved all the stained glass Rose Windows except for one that was lost when the glass melted.

They did an inspection today and said that though the roof and spire collapsed, they saved the Bell Towers and the walls are relatively in good shape, though one area needs to be reinforced, but it looks good for a restoration. Though they say it may take decades to restore it.

There were 3 millionaires who have pledged a combined $300+ million for the restoration work.
